Social media can play a part in this," Paul said. Usually up to 15 cruising and landing boats, full to capacity, would take to the water at this time of year to visit Skellig Michael. You can't just let people forget Skellig Michael, it's a site of global importance, and you must keep it out there," he added. Interest in bookings for cruises to Skellig Michael has been 'steady' in recent weeks according to Paul. "It's important that the people who do take boat trips record it and share it on social media, it lets the world know we're still open."
